Sat 1342825620618974

decimal
327130.620618974
degree
0°117130′538″620618974‴
percentile
63.944077242670616%
name
eikuxopzbdr
cycle
0
epoch
1
period
162
block
327130
offset
620618974
timestamp
rarity
common